[ ] Day one: remind the new starter we're at the Copperline Annex while Ferris House gets its renovation done — same desk setup, just follow the yellow wayfinding arrows from the tram stop. Lockers are first-come. The annex side door stays locked all day, so they'll need the entry code below.

badge for fafop-fajof: bdg-Z-47

# Approvals: Fan-out Backpressure

Heads up, future maintainers: any change to the Pushpinnacle notification fan-out — queue depths, shed thresholds, retry curves — needs sign-off before merge. We learned this the hard way during the Birchmoor incident, when an untuned limit flooded downstream workers. Small tweaks count too. The approver for all backpressure changes is listed below.

account owner for bawip-tahag: Raleth Quenok

### Step 4: Pin your dependencies

All Quartzline plugins must pin exact versions in `plugin.lock`; ranges and wildcards are rejected at publish time. Re-pin after every upstream Quartzline minor release and run the compatibility check locally. The publish tool needs registry access, so add this line to your environment file:

secret setting of yafof-tawep: RELAY_SECRET8=8abb5772